Measurements of the nuclear modification factor and elliptic flow of leptons from heavy-flavour hadron decays in Pb--Pb collisions at = 2.76 and 5.02 TeV with ALICE
We present the ALICE results on the nuclear modification factor and elliptic
flow of electrons and muons from open heavy-flavour hadron decays at
mid-rapidity and forward rapidity in Pb--Pb collisions at =
2.76 and 5.02 TeV for different centrality intervals. The results are compared
to model calculations that include interactions of heavy quarks with the
medium.Comment: 5 pages, 4 figure
Anxiety in women with lymphedema following treatment for breast cancer
Aim: The aim of the present study was to evaluate anxiety in women with lymphedema following treatment for breast cancer. Method: A cross-sectional study was conducted involving 32 consecutive patients with lymphedema stemming from breast cancer treatment. Women with lymphedema due to other causes were excluded. Anxiety was evaluated using the Beck Anxiety Inventory. Descriptive statistics were used for the analysis of events. Results: Among the 32 patients evaluated, 10 (31.25%) had a minimal level of anxiety, 10 (31.25%) had mild anxiety, seven (21.85%) has moderate anxiety and had mild to moderate depression and five (15.62%) had severe anxiety. Lipoedema and varicose vein surgery: a worse prognosis?
The case of a 22-year-old patient who suffered from lipoedema of the lower limbs and underwent aesthetic
surgery for varicose veins is reported. After surgery the patient started to present a sensation of heaviness,
oedema and tiredness of the limbs. It was observed that the haematomas took about eight months to
disappear. The diameter of the legs increased by 4 centimetres in this period. The aim of this publication is to
warn about this happening in patients suffering from lipoedema who are then submitted to varicose vein

Physiopathological Hypothesis of Cellulite
A series of questions are asked concerning this condition including as regards to its name, the consensus about the histopathological findings, physiological hypothesis and treatment of the disease. We established a hypothesis for cellulite and confirmed that the clinical response is compatible with this hypothesis. Hence this novel approach brings a modern physiological concept with physiopathologic basis and clinical proof of the hypothesis. We emphasize that the choice of patient, correct diagnosis of cellulite and the technique employed are fundamental to success
